    The authors investigate oscillation properties of the nonlinear third order differential equation \((*)\) \(u'''+ q(t)u'+ p(t)u^ \alpha= 0\), where the functions \(p\), \(q\), \(q'\) are continuous and \(\alpha>1\) is a ratio of two prime natural numbers. The starting point for this investigation are the ``linear'' oscillation results given in the monograph of the first author [Third order linear differential equations, Reidel, Dordrecht (1987; Zbl 0602.34005)]. Some of these results are extended using the linearization technique to \((*)\). A typical statement is contained in the following theorem. Theorem. Let \(q\leq 0\), \(q'<0\), \(p>0\) for \(t\in (a,\infty)\) and let the second order equation \(y''+ q(t)y= 0\) be disconjugate in \((a,\infty)\) (i.e., no nontrivial solution has more than one zero in \((a,\infty)\)). If \(\int^ \infty tp(t)dt= \infty\), then each solution of \((*)\) defined on \([t_ 0,\infty)\) \((t_ 0\geq a)\) with one zero oscillates in \([t_ 0,\infty)\). The results and methods of the paper are closely related to those given in the authors' papers [Arch. Math. Brno 28, 221-228 (1992; Zbl 0781.34026) and ibid. 28, 51-55 (1992; Zbl 0781.34024)].
